Overview
The Welder position involves welding various pre-fitted assemblies for Columbia-class submarines, Virginia-class submarines, Gerald R. Ford-class aircraft carriers, and associated fixtures, adhering to NAVSEA and/or AWS D1.1 specifications.
Responsibilities
- Weld proficiently in all positions with minimal defects.
- Determine the correct equipment and method based on requirements.
- Perform basic welding machine setup and troubleshooting.
- Read and interpret welding symbols.
- Have basic knowledge of grinding, gouging, and weld repair.
- Stay focused and on-task at all times.
- Complete jobs within budget and timeline.
- Accept constructive criticism and show improvement.
- Comply with all safety requirements and protocols.
- Perform other related duties as assigned.
Requirements
- Successful completion of 7 weld tests: FCAW (2G, 3G, and 4G); GWAW-Pulsed (2G, 3G, and 4G); GMAW-Spray (2G).
- Successful completion of Pegasus Welder Workmanship Training (WWT).
- Successful completion of Pegasus Welder I Performance Qualification Standards within 90 days of hire.
- High school diploma or GED.
- Successful completion of an accredited trade school welding program or equivalent, or 2-years demonstrated practical AWS D1.1 welding experience, or a comparable combination of education and experience.
